Form 4: Stepan Co. Executive David Kabbes Reports Acquisition of Common Stock
SEC Form 4 Filing
David Kabbes, VP, GC & Secretary of Stepan Co., reports acquiring common stock through an ESOP II Trust.
Summary
- On February 21, 2025, David Kabbes, VP, GC & Secretary of Stepan Co. (SCL), acquired 57.412 shares of common stock at a price of $62.53 per share.
- Following the transaction, Kabbes beneficially owns 401.74 shares indirectly through an ESOP II Trust and 12,004.8917 shares indirectly through the DGK Living Trust.
